See the GNU Lesser General Public License for more details. * * You should have received a copy of the GNU Lesser General Public License along * with this library; if not, write to the Free Software Foundation, Inc., * 59 Temple Place, Suite 330, Boston, MA 02111-1307 USA */ import java.io.IOException; import java.util.ArrayList; import java.util.Arrays; import java.util.Collections; import java.util.Comparator; import java.util.List; import java.util.Properties; import org.slf4j.Logger; import org.slf4j.LoggerFactory; import org.springframework.beans.BeansException; import org.springframework.beans.factory.config.ConfigurableListableBeanFactory; import org.springframework.beans.factory.config.PropertyPlaceholderConfigurer; import org.springframework.core.io.support.PathMatchingResourcePatternResolver; import org.springframework.core.io.Resource; /** * An extension of {@link PropertyPlaceholderConfigurer}. Provides runtime additions of properties and wildcard location lookups. * * Properties can be added at runtime by using the static {@link #addGlobalProperty} *before* the bean definition is instantiated * in the ApplicationContext. A property added by {@link #addGlobalProperty} will get merged into properties specified by the * bean definition, overriding keys that overlap. * * wildcard locations can be used instead of locations, if both are declared the last will override. Wildcard locations are * handled by {@link #setWildcardLocations(String[])}, using {@link PathMatchingResourcePatternResolver} for matching locations. * For wildcard locations that matches multiple Properties files, they are merged in by alphabetical filename order. * * @author Michael Guymon (michael.guymon@gmail.com) * */ public class ExtendedPropertyPlaceholderConfigurer extends PropertyPlaceholderConfigurer { private static Logger logger = LoggerFactory.getLogger( ExtendedPropertyPlaceholderConfigurer.class ); private static Properties globalPlaceholderProperties = new Properties(); private Properties mergedProperties; @Override protected void processProperties( ConfigurableListableBeanFactory beanFactoryToProcess, Properties props) throws BeansException { props.putAll( copyOfGlobalProperties() ); logger.debug( "Placeholder props: {}", props.toString() ); this.mergedProperties = props; super.processProperties( beanFactoryToProcess, props ); } /** * Merged {@link Properties} created by {@link #processProperties} * * @return {@link Properties} */ public Properties getMergedProperties() { return mergedProperties; } /** * String[] of wildcard locations of properties that are converted to Resource[] using * using {@link PathMatchingResourcePatternResolver} * * @param locations String[] * @throws IOException */ public void setWildcardLocations( String[] locations ) throws IOException { List<Resource> resources = new ArrayList<Resource>(); PathMatchingResourcePatternResolver resolver = new PathMatchingResourcePatternResolver( this.getClass().getClassLoader() ); for( String location: locations ) { logger.debug( "Loading location {}", location ); try { // Get all Resources for a wildcard location Resource[] configs = resolver.getResources(location); if ( configs != null && configs.length > 0) { List<Resource> resourceGroup = new ArrayList<Resource>(); for ( Resource resource: configs ) { logger.debug( "Loading {} for location {}", resource.getFilename(), location ); resourceGroup.add( resource ); } // Sort all Resources for a wildcard location by filename Collections.sort( resourceGroup, new ResourceFilenameComparator() ); // Add to master List resources.addAll( resourceGroup ); } else { logger.info( "Wildcard location does not exist: {}", location ); } } catch (IOException ioException) { logger.error( "Failed to resolve location: {} - {}", location, ioException ); } } this.setLocations( ( Resource[] )resources.toArray( new Resource[resources.size()] ) ); } /** * Add a global property to be merged * * @param key String * @param val String */ public static synchronized void addGlobalProperty( String key, String val ) { globalPlaceholderProperties.setProperty( key, val ); } /** * Copy of the manual properties * * @return {@link Properties} */ private static synchronized Properties copyOfGlobalProperties() { // return new Properties( runtimeProperties ); returns an empty prop ?? Properties prop = new Properties(); prop.putAll( globalPlaceholderProperties ); return prop; } public class ResourceFilenameComparator implements Comparator<Resource> { @Override public int compare( Resource resource1, Resource resource2 ) { if ( resource1 != null ) { if ( resource2 != null ) { return resource1.getFilename().compareTo( resource2.getFilename() ); } else { return 1; } } else if ( resource2 == null ) { return 0; } else { return -1; } } } }
